Hi, A bit out of my area here, ok its Leibstandarte but whats the relevance of the number, looks like a '2'(?) and the laurel/branch (?)on the insignia, Any suggestions as to a date or theatre? Jim.

SS-Panzer-Grenadier-Regiment 2, 18.Aufklärungs-Kompanie.

The laurel wreath was standard LAH insignia 1943-45.

Date? Only a guess, late in the war - Ardennes - as part of XXXIX Korps, 5. Pz. Armee.

I don't think this photo was taken in the Ardennes as all the pictures taken during this period show that the LSSAH's SPW were painted in white. Moreover, when LSSAH was part of the 5.Panzerarmee, the weather had turned into an intense cold and the men had to wear the warmest possible clothes. Finally, the 18.(Aufkl.)Kp./SS-Pz.Gren.Rgt.2 was no longer in existence by December 1944.
